dobby, from the ESF Risoul website:
10th Feb is NOT classed as a peak week so:
6 morning lessons 9.30 a.m. to 12.00 p.m. ESF meeting point €109
6 morning & Ski Pass (Flocon et 1ere Etoile) 9.30 a.m. to 12.00 p.m. ESF meeting point €219
6 afternoon lessons 2.00 to 4.30 p.m. ESF meeting point €109
6 afternoon & Ski Pass (Flocon et 1ere Etoile) 2.00 to 4.30 p.m. ESF meeting point €219
ESF seem to do half days. I would contact Crystal and see whats going on
